First, letʼs make the meat bolognese sauce. Peel the onion, rinse and cut into cubes.

Step 3

Step 3
Heat vegetable oil in a frying pan and fry the onion over low heat until transparent.

Step 4

Step 4
Now add the minced meat to the onion and mix well. Fry over medium heat for about five minutes, stirring occasionally, breaking up large lumps in the minced meat.

Step 5

Step 5
Add tomato sauce, salt and seasonings. I always use dry Italian herbs for lasagna. You can take any spices to your taste. Stir and simmer on low heat for about twenty minutes. Turn off the heat. Meat bolognese sauce is ready.

Step 6

Step 6
How to make bechamel sauce for lasagna? Melt the butter in a saucepan.

Step 7

Step 7
Add flour and quickly fry the flour in butter. It is necessary to stir vigorously so that the flour does not burn. When a “velvet” coating appears at the bottom, pour in the milk.

Step 8

Step 8
Pour in the milk in a thin stream, stirring vigorously with a whisk until the flour mixture is well dissolved. When this happens, continue heating the sauce, stirring constantly, until thickened. It should almost boil and start to bubble.

Step 9

Step 9
Turn off the heat, add salt to taste and add nutmeg. Mix well. Bechamel is ready. Let it cool a little.

Step 10

Step 10
While our sauces are being prepared, we need to cook the pasta until half cooked. Boil water, add salt and add pasta and cook for half the time indicated on the package. Place the pasta in a colander and let the water drain.

Grate the cheese on a coarse grater. You can use any cheese, the main thing is that it is fresh, of high quality, without vegetable fats and melts well.

Step 12

Step 12
Letʼs start assembling our lazy homemade lasagna. Pour a few spoons of white sauce into the bottom of the pan and spread it over the bottom.

Step 13

Step 13
Next, spread an even layer of pasta.

Step 14

Step 14
Bechamel again on top.

Step 15

Step 15
Then spread the meat sauce evenly.

Step 16

Step 16
There is a layer of grated cheese on it.

Step 17

Step 17
Next, repeat the layers: pasta, bechamel, bolognese, cheese. I have a small mold, so I only got two layers, if you have more, repeat. There should always be meat sauce and cheese on top. Place the pan in an oven preheated to 200 degrees for about 30-40 minutes until the top is browned. Baking times and temperatures may vary; adjust them based on the operating characteristics of your oven. Place the lasagna on plates and serve.
